What Voice Do You Heed

The subtle internal darkness 
Whispers sweet lies to my waiting ears
To believe in things i never should
And play upon my fears
My thoughts are sorted and processed
Distinguishing whats wrong and right
So i dont get swallowed by the evil
Its a never ending fight.
I watch atrocities accross the globe
Of those who succumb to wicked lies
They know not what God they serve
As another innocent child sadly dies
When we all stand before our Creator
And the cold truth will be revealed
You will be judged by what voice you heeded
And yor eternal fate will be sealed.
